普洱茶中没食子酸及其改善饮食诱导的糖脂代谢紊乱研究进展

摘    要:糖脂代谢紊乱是引发心血管疾病、糖尿病和脂肪肝的重要原因之一。普洱茶中的没食子酸能够通过调节能量代谢和脂肪细胞分化、促进葡萄糖吸收与利用、提高胰岛素敏感性,进而改善饮食诱导引起的葡萄糖和脂质代谢紊乱。没食子酸通过AMPK途径、IR-Akt途径以及PPAR-γ受体调节线粒体能量代谢、胰岛素敏感性和葡萄糖吸收,从而维持糖脂代谢稳态。本文综述了普洱茶中的没食子酸及其改善饮食诱导的糖脂代谢紊乱作用和作用机制的研究进展。

Research Progress of Gallic Acid in Puer Tea and Its Improvement of Diet Induced Glucose and Lipid Metabolism Disorder

Abstract:The disorder of glucose and lipid metabolism is one of the important causes of cardiovascular diseases, diabetes and fatty liver. Gallic acid of Puer tea can ameliorate diet induced glucose and lipid metabolism disorder through regulating energy metabolism and adipocyte differentiation, promoting glucose absorption and utilization, and increasing insulin sensitivity. Gallic acid regulates mitochondrial energy metabolism, insulin sensitivity and glucose absorption to maintain glucose and lipid metabolism homeostasis through AMPK and IR-Akt pathway and PPAR gamma receptor. In this review, we summarized gallic acid in Puer tea and its mechanism to improve the disorder of glucose and lipid metabolism induced by diet.
